SERMONS #25 – The Silence of the Lambs (9/28/22)

29:56 – The death squads of the gods fan out across Egypt, finally convincing Pharaoh to release the Israelite slaves, who have stocked up on borrowed goods that they have no intention of returning. (Is that any way to treat thy neighbors?) The ensuing blood bath is enough to make Dave in Kentucky consider pollo-pescatarianism. How many children of Israel set out on the Exodus? Did they leave from the city of Rameses, or from Avaris? And what’s so special about unleavened bread?

The Midnight Citizen 245: “Time Tourism”

1:06:45 — Join Mike on a trip to the 1893 World’s Fair in Chicago, courtesy of the Get Back (Time) Travel Agency…

…where rides on the world’s first people mover and Mr. Ferris’s Wheel make him discover that tourists are all the same, wanting to be entertained through the least amount of effort possible. Also, he attempts an Escape Room at the Murder Castle of H.H. Holmes, America’s First Serial Killer, when a millennial employee of the attraction “Quiet Quits”, leaving him to the clutches of the fiend.
